Output 3a4fa882c817ee27aa85e9d1bae37f551f5b258b3b579f98cfaa2255e69a249f:0

value
181016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52f326234607925b6ea44661bfc04a2d488c586 OP_EQUAL
address
3M8EPhJ5qefxZWFJ3G25C1JUD1KHAswTpB
transaction
3a4fa882c817ee27aa85e9d1bae37f551f5b258b3b579f98cfaa2255e69a249f
spent
true